We have an exciting and unique opportunity for a Fixed Income Quantitative Analyst to join a successful, highly-regarded team within LGIM. This role will contribute to the development of both systems infrastructure and quantitative fixed income models to support the investment, risk and attribution capabilities of the team
What you'll be doing
- Developing and continually enhancing the data and model platform and associated analytics used to support investment, risk, attribution, new business development and new asset classes
- Contribute to the development of quantitative fixed income models and associated governance framework to support investment, risk, attribution and pricing portfolio construction
- Work with the Annuity team members as well the Insurance Client Team and portfolio management to deliver robust, relevant and scalable analytical solutions
- Build intellectual capital by performing strategic research and analysis that applies the latest financial knowledge to topical issues in the industry while working with other team members
- Take part in IT systems projects and business process projects that affect the team and related business areas
- Ensure effective utilisation of enhanced data, analytical, risk engine and portfolio management capabilities
- Collaborate with associated teams (e.g. collateral management/margining; derivative pricing) to ensure new operational/business processes are implemented in the most effective way
- Support investment analysis relevant to the client balance sheet and the Investment Management Agreement
- Ensure relevant instruments are priced and analysed in line with market conventions and methods and can be reported on appropriately
- To include evaluating actual and potential collateral use where products are collateralised or margined
- Ensure that any actions taken with respect to managing client portfolios are in accordance with LGIM’s Treating Customers Fairly policy
- Strong fixed income modelling knowledge including derivatives across credit, rates and inflation
- Good knowledge of risk management practices and practical constraints in implementation
- Understanding of a broad range of investment management concepts such as efficient frontiers, capital asset pricing model, active vs. index, etc.
- High degree of proficiency with IT including strong programming skills in at least one language
- Knowledge of the regulatory and legislative landscape as it relates to pension schemes and to de-risking
- Prior exposure to work involving pension schemes and/or insurance clients
- Ability to execute quickly on client projects including data gathering and validation
- Python, Matlab or C# programming experience is a plus
- Building and maintaining models for pricing, portfolio construction and portfolio management of derivative strategies designed to hedge risks and enhance returns
